Send an email to admin
About us
Neo Space, your work space partner…that bring workspaces to Life. We provide a fully integrated 360 degree solution to commercial property, advising on workplace design, fit-out and maintenance.
Get Direction - Google Map
Categories Listed in
Related Business
Ratings